  • Guarding Your Soul in an Unpredictable World
    2026/04/08

    This episode reflects on the Stoic call to care for your own soul.


    Marcus Aurelius warns that misery comes not from ignoring others, but from neglecting the activity of our own mind.


    Seneca adds that a well-formed soul—guided by reason, courage, and discipline—becomes independent of fortune, because its true wealth lies within.

  • How Strange It Is, What People Do
    2026/04/01

    This episode looks at how Stoicism handles insults without turning us into “unfeeling statues.”


    Epictetus suggests taking a cue from a stone: insults only work if we grant them importance.


    When we pause and refuse that inner assent, the words lose their grip.

  • Aphorisms for Action: Making Stoicism Stick
    2026/03/25

    This episode explores how Stoicism moves from theory to instinct.


    The ancients distilled complex teachings into sharp, portable aphorisms—short phrases designed to steady the mind under pressure.


    From Delphic maxims to Cicero’s call to let reason govern impulse, these lines function as mental anchors when stress rises.
